[Music] in the event of a medical emergency the assistance a casualty receives in the first few minutes even seconds can easily make the difference between life and death first aid is intended to fill this critical gap until professional medical assistants can arrive employers have a legal duty to assess the first aid risks in their workplace and provide suitable arrangements as a minimum this will involve the provision of a first aid box and nominating named individuals to coordinate the provision of first aid dependent on size and risk employers must also provide specialist hands-on training to provide so-called qualified first aiders this training program provides a basic introduction to first aid at work it is intended to assist nominated first aid coordinators as well as providing everyone with simple guidance that can be followed until a qualified first aider or medical professional arrives to begin with prepare yourself by making sure you know where your first aid box is locate

Risk = Likelihood x Severity The risk is how likely it is that harm will occur, against how serious that harm could be. The more likely it is that harm will happen, and the more severe the harm, the higher the risk. And before you can control risk, you need to know what level of risk you are facing.

5 steps in the risk assessment process Identify the hazards. Determine who might be harmed and how. Evaluate the risks and take precautions. Record your findings. Review your assessment and update if necessary.
